At 40, Hoda Kotb’s world fell apart—cancer, divorce, and the dream of having children slipping away. But what came next wasn’t the end. It was a beginning.In this amazing episode, Hoda opens up about surviving breast cancer, finding the courage to adopt at 52, and learning that her 50s would become the most meaningful years of her life. She shares raw moments, unexpected joy, and the wisdom that only comes from starting over.If you're navigating change or wondering if it's too late to begin again, this episode will speak straight to your heart.
